    • Displaying unsimplified expressions

      The following works in Maple proper, but not in Mobius.  Why is that?

      use InertForm:-NoSimpl in a:=2*(3*x) end use;
      InertForm:-Display(a);

      My goal is to display 2(3x) or even 2*(3*x). But definitely not 6x. Works in Maple, but Mobius gives Typesetting errors when I try to use Display.

      I'm trying to avoid solutions that involve strings since that introduces a whole other can of worms regarding whether or not the signs are positive/negative, and whether or not 1's should be displayed ...

    • Grading equations in a specific form

      I am struggling to find a way to create a maple graded question, that accepts a quadratic equation, but only in a specific form.  For instance,

      I need one question that only accepts as correct the standard form, another one that only accepts factored form, and other that only accepts vertex form.

      Maple treats all three as equivalent (because they are) but how then can I restrict a student to use a particular form?

      As a side question, I seem to have better luck when the response area is only used for the RHS of the equation.  Whenever I try to have a maple graded response area that includes "y=" as part of the correct answer, I get all kinds of errors.  Why is this?
